I didn't want to spend much money, so I headed to the local Dollar Store and Target.
We are going to start with the H is for Halloween unit. We're going to focus mostly on the pumpkin activities... and maybe some of the bats. I'm not sure he'd even understand about ghosts or anything like that at this point.


For $12 we picked up some crayons, pompoms and stickers for crafts, google eyes and spiders for sensory boxes, foam pumpkins, orange paper plates and crepe paper streamers. The most expensive thing was the crayons!

I also found a few things for some of the other units -

A package each of foam turkeys and leaves for 
And a DIY turkey placemat for the Thanksgiving unit coming up in November.
Each from the Target $1 bins.
